diff options
-rw-r--r-- | conky-irc/MAX_SP.patch (renamed from conky/MAX_SP.patch) | 0 | ||||
-rw-r--r-- | conky-irc/PKGBUILD (renamed from conky/PKGBUILD) | 16 | ||||
-rw-r--r-- | conky-irc/lua53.patch (renamed from conky/lua53.patch) | 0 |
3 files changed, 10 insertions, 6 deletions
diff --git a/conky/MAX_SP.patch b/conky-irc/MAX_SP.patch index 9c75fbc99..9c75fbc99 100644 --- a/conky/MAX_SP.patch +++ b/conky-irc/MAX_SP.patch diff --git a/conky/PKGBUILD b/conky-irc/PKGBUILD index 4b4904424..77b4252f4 100644 --- a/conky/PKGBUILD +++ b/conky-irc/PKGBUILD @@ -5,10 +5,12 @@ # Contributor: James Rayner <james@archlinux.org> # Contributor: Partha Chowdhury <kira.laucas@gmail.com> -pkgname=conky +pkgname=conky-irc pkgver=1.10.8 +provides=("conky=${pkgver}") +conflicts=('conky') pkgrel=1 -pkgdesc='Lightweight system monitor for X' +pkgdesc='Lightweight system monitor for X - with irc-client enabled' url='https://github.com/brndnmtthws/conky' license=('BSD' 'GPL') arch=('i686' 'x86_64') @@ -16,7 +18,7 @@ makedepends=('cmake' 'docbook2x' 'docbook-xml' 'man-db' 'git') depends=('glib2' 'lua' 'wireless_tools' 'libxdamage' 'libxinerama' 'libxft' 'imlib2' 'libxml2' 'libpulse' 'libircclient') optdepends=('mounted') -source=("https://github.com/brndnmtthws/conky/archive/v${pkgver}.tar.gz" +source=("${pkgname%-irc}-${pkgver}.tar.gz::https://github.com/brndnmtthws/conky/archive/v${pkgver}.tar.gz" 'lua53.patch' 'MAX_SP.patch') sha512sums=('743b1d17db4ae654c7a319fe9157e9ebc5eb4ae0462a1f7269332d379e8bdd1dbfecc3ab6f46c8b5176b7e40918301649ac3ee883a84dc4fc8d766abbac6585a' @@ -26,7 +28,7 @@ sha512sums=('743b1d17db4ae654c7a319fe9157e9ebc5eb4ae0462a1f7269332d379e8bdd1dbfe options=('!strip' 'debug') prepare() { - cd "${srcdir}/${pkgname}-${pkgver}" + cd "${srcdir}/${pkgname%-irc}-${pkgver}" patch -p1 -i ../lua53.patch # lua_gettable returns an int in lua-5.3 patch -p1 -i ../MAX_SP.patch sed '/^#include / s,<libircclient\.h>,<libircclient/libircclient.h>,' -i 'src/irc.cc' @@ -34,19 +36,21 @@ prepare() { } build() { - cd "${srcdir}/${pkgname}-${pkgver}" + cd "${srcdir}/${pkgname%-irc}-${pkgver}" cmake \ -D CMAKE_BUILD_TYPE=Release \ -D MAINTAINER_MODE=ON \ -D BUILD_WLAN=ON \ -D BUILD_XDBE=ON \ + -D BUILD_XSHAPE=ON \ -D BUILD_IMLIB2=ON \ -D BUILD_CURL=ON \ -D BUILD_RSS=ON \ -D BUILD_WEATHER_METAR=ON \ -D BUILD_WEATHER_XOAP=ON \ -D BUILD_PULSEAUDIO=ON \ + -D BUILD_JOURNAL=ON \ -D BUILD_IRC=ON \ -D CMAKE_INSTALL_PREFIX=/usr \ . @@ -55,7 +59,7 @@ build() { } package() { - cd "${srcdir}/${pkgname}-${pkgver}" + cd "${srcdir}/${pkgname%-irc}-${pkgver}" make DESTDIR="${pkgdir}" install install -Dm644 COPYING "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" install -Dm644 extras/vim/syntax/conkyrc.vim "${pkgdir}"/usr/share/vim/vimfiles/syntax/conkyrc.vim diff --git a/conky/lua53.patch b/conky-irc/lua53.patch index daab12646..daab12646 100644 --- a/conky/lua53.patch +++ b/conky-irc/lua53.patch |